I
would hazard a guess that most studio engineers will not recognize the D.A.S.
name, as the Spanish companys last studio monitor was produced roughly
20 years ago. Established in 1970, D.A.S. began as a manufacturer of studio
monitors before changing its focus to produce loudspeakers for sound reinforcement
applications. The company has returned to its roots with the introduction
of its Monitor line of near- to midfield recording and broadcast studio
monitors. The Monitor-8s and their smaller sibling, the Monitor-6s, are
the first offerings in the expanding product line. The larger Monitor-8s
are reviewed here.
At $459 each ($918/pair), the Monitor-8s are modestly priced, so I was completely
surprised by what I heard when I first auditioned these superb passive monitors
in my control room. In short, I was completely blown away. The Monitor-8s
are world-class monitors offered at a bargain-basement price.
First Look
Straight out of the box,
the Monitor-8s are beautiful to behold. The heavily radiused side panels
are fashioned from exotic Iroko plywood, adding rigidity as well as visual
contrast to the black, 15mm-thick MDF cabinet. This reinforcement minimizes
coloration from panel vibration. The top and bottom edges of the cabinet
are not radiused. Cabinet dimensions (with a vertical orientation) are 16.5x11x11.5
inches (HxWxD). Each cabinet weighs 28 pounds. The monitors are not magnetically
shielded.
Behind the detachable, black cloth grille are two driversan 8-inch
polypropylene woofer with a rubber surround and a 1-inch soft-dome, ultra-fine
aluminum diaphragm tweeter. The low-frequency drivers oversized motor
structures and cast-aluminum chassis promise improved efficiency and impulse
response. The tweeters voice coils are Ferrofluid-cooled for maximum
power handling and improved linearity.
The tweeter sits behind a protective fine-mesh metal grille. Both the tweeter
and grille are inset in a Linear Quadratic Spherical waveguide, the
curved shape that reportedly reduces diffractive effects at high frequencies
(the radiused side panels make a similar contribution). The result is wider,
more uniform imaging and less distortion due to comb filtering. The waveguide
also increases the tweeters sensitivity.
A circular bass tuning port is on the rear panel, directly opposite the
high-frequency driver. Also on the rear panel are two binding posts that
provide power amp connections; these accept only bare wire. Two M6 (metric
6) female mounting points are located on the bottom of the cabinet that
allows the monitors to be anchored to a flat stand with a downward tilt.
Specs
The Monitor-8s are rated
at 125-watt RMS power, 250W program power and over 500W peak power handling
capability; D.A.S. recommends an amplifier rated at 125 to 250 watts at
eight ohms. The specified peak SPL at full power is 116 dB, and I found
a stereo pair of Monitor-8s to be plenty loud when powered by my 150-watt
Hafler P-3000 Transnova amp. On-axis sensitivity (1 watt/1 meter)
is a respectable 89dB SPL.
The Monitor-8s frequency response is specified as 38 to 33 kHz (with
no tolerances given). D.A.S. recommends you place the Monitor-8s four inches
from a wall for added reinforcement of bass frequencies, and a supplied
chart shows the frequency response one would ideally expect with such placement.
The response is three dBs down at 55 Hz and two dBs down at 20 kHz, with
impressive linearity in between both extremes. (These measurements were
made using a 1W swept sine signal at one meter with the Monitor-8s in a
half-space anechoic environment. (For more information, see the sidebar
On the Bench.) The crossover point for the 12dB/octave Linkwitz-Riley
passive crossover is 3 kHz.
